Fintiri Announces 4,000 Job Vacancies

Adamawa State Governor, Rt. Hon. Ahmadu Umaru Fintiri CON has directed the State Civil Service Commission to open a recruitment portal for 4,000 new members of the state’s workforce.

The approval for the recruitment exercise to fill vacancies across various Ministries, Departments, and Agencies (MDAS) in the state takes effect from midnight on Tuesday, April 29th, to May 12th, 2025.

Eligible candidates must possess relevant qualifications and be ready to produce original copies of their credentials at the interview venue.

Those who attended the last aborted interview can reapply.

Governor Fintiri is committed to improving the living standards of the citizens, particularly the youth. Governor Fintiri’s administration prioritises job creation to ensure no one is idle.
